How they compare
Saudi Arabia currently reports 1,712 kt against 1,465 kt in Lithuania, a difference of 247 kt.
That makes Saudi Arabia's figure about 1.2 times Lithuania's.
The two have swapped places 2 times across 32 shared years of data; in 1992 it was Saudi Arabia ahead.
Lithuania ranks 24th and Saudi Arabia ranks 21st of 199 countries.
Across the 4 decades both report, Lithuania averaged higher in 3 and Saudi Arabia in 1.
Head to head by decade
| Decade | Lithuania | Saudi Arabia | Difference | Ahead |
|---|---|---|---|---|
| 1990s | 712.85 kt | 767.51 kt | 54.66 kt | Saudi Arabia |
| 2000s | 1,642 kt | 956.65 kt | 685.02 kt | Lithuania |
| 2010s | 2,105 kt | 1,293 kt | 812.23 kt | Lithuania |
| 2020s | 1,704 kt | 1,650 kt | 54.33 kt | Lithuania |
Averages of every year both report within each decade.

About this data
The FAOSTAT domain on Emissions Totals summarizes the greenhouse gas (GHG) emissions disseminated in the FAOSTAT Climate Change domains of emissions from agrifood systems. Data are computed following the Tier 1 methods of the Intergovernmental Panel on Climate Change (IPCC) Guidelines for National greenhouse gas (GHG) Inventories (IPCC, 1996; 1997; 2000; 2002; 2006; 2014). Emissions from other economic sectors as defined by the IPCC are also disseminated in the domain for completeness.
